Abstract Healthcare waste disposal management is one of the biggest day-to-day\n challenges faced by healthcare providers and urban municipalities. Poor\n management of healthcare waste can cause serious problems for healthcare\n workers, patients, and the general public. Healthcare providers and\n urban planners usually struggle with the action of locating an\n appropriate waste disposal center in a municipal area. Healthcare waste\n disposal location planning is a difficult task due to complexities\n inherent in the evaluation of alternative locations according to\n multiple and often competing criteria. We propose a new best-worst\n method with interval rough numbers (IRN) for healthcare waste disposal\n location decisions. A new IRN Dombi-Bonferroni (IRNDBM) means the\n operator is also introduced to process the rough data because of the\n unavailability of precise information. A case study at a private\n hospital in Madrid is presented to demonstrate the applicability and\n exhibit the efficacy of the proposed multi-criteria evaluation method.
